Abstract
The invention discloses a kind ofly with vinasse, particularly the potato distiller's dried grain is the mixed feed and the method for manufacturing technology thereof of Main Ingredients and Appearance, and its Main Ingredients and Appearance is distiller's dried grain, corn flour, potato dry powder, wheat bran, soya-bean cake, fish meal and oyster spiro powder etc.Adopted centrifugal solid-liquid separation, normal temperature fermentation, sneaked into mixing oven dry, carrier separation, the pulverizing of carrier and add the batch mixes method and make.Solved the difficult problem that traditional vinasse are difficult for being processed into the commodity dry feed.This vinasse mixed feed good palatability, cost is low, and feeding effect is obvious, saves food, reduces environmental pollution.
Description
The invention discloses a kind ofly with vinasse, particularly the potato distiller's dried grain is the mixed feed and the method for manufacturing technology thereof of Main Ingredients and Appearance.
At present, domestic brewery, Alcohol Plant to do with potato be the quite a lot of raw material production liquor or alcohol.Residue in the production process-potato distiller's dried grain, because its water content is big, viscosity height, granularity are little, are difficult to be processed into dry feed and sell.Generally by directly as feeding livestock and poultry feed.Because transportation and storage inconvenience so its utilization rate is not high, are fallen as waste discharge greatly, promptly contaminated environment is wasted grain again.In addition, contain a large amount of higher alcohols, acidic materials and volatilization fat in the poor liquid of vinasse, cause raising livestock and poultry palatability poor, be unfavorable for digesting and assimilating.Above-mentioned many disadvantages has influenced the extensive use of vinasse as feed.So invent a kind of potato vinasse mixed feed and preparation method thereof for the exploitation feed resource, to save food, elimination environmental pollution etc. all has great economic benefit and social benefit.
The purpose of this invention is to provide a kind of that be convenient to transport and store, feeding effect is good, cost is low potato distiller's dried grain mixed feed and preparation method thereof.
Technical essential of the present invention is that the poor liquid of will discharge in the process of brewing alcoholic beverages carries out the fresh grain stillage that Separation of Solid and Liquid obtains water content 70%-80%, add the spontaneous fermentation at normal temperatures of fodder yeast bacterium then, fresh grain stillage after will fermenting is then sneaked into an amount of distills ' grains or rice husk as carrier, mix oven dry, distiller's dried grain after will drying again separates, pulverizes, and adds an amount of batch mixes and evenly makes mixed feed.

Below introduce the manufacture process of potato distiller's dried grain mixed feed in detail: a kind of method of manufacturing technology of vinasse mixed feed, the liquid that it is characterized in that being pickled with grains or in wine carries out centrifugal solid-liquid earlier to be separated, obtain the fresh grain stillage of water content lower (70~80%), admix the normal temperature fermentation that an amount of fodder yeast bacterium carries out then under natural placement condition, fresh grain stillage after the fermentation is sneaked into rice husk or distills ' grains is carrier mixing oven dry, again the distiller's dried grain group of oven dry is carried out pulverizing after carrier separates and make the distiller's dried grain powder, it is even to add batch mixes at last, makes the vinasse mixed feed.
Process conditions and requirement in the manufacture process of the present invention are: Separation of Solid and Liquid has adopted multistage (more than the two-stage) centrifugal solid-liquid separation method, and equipment can be selected horizontal spiral discharge sedimentation centrifuge for use.The water content of the fresh grain stillage after the Separation of Solid and Liquid can be controlled in 70~80%, and the rate of recovery of solid content is more than 80%.The ratio of admixing the fodder yeast bacterium is to can be controlled between 24~36 hours 3~5% times of carrying out normal temperature fermentation under natural placement condition of weight.Adopted the drying machine of vibrated fluidized bed formula that fresh grain stillage and carrier are carried out combination drying among the present invention.The temperature of dry-heat air is 120 ℃~130 ℃.The mixed proportion (percent by volume) of oven dry carrier is: rice husk is 25~35%, and distills ' grains is 35~45%.Vinasse water content after the oven dry can be controlled in 10~14%.Can adopt two drying machine series connection to use in case of necessity, to improve rate of drying and heat utilization efficiency.The disintegrating process process does not have specific (special) requirements, generally by the mixed feed granularity requirements dried vinasse cooking starch is broken to meet standard-required and get final product.Later adding batch mixes packaging process mainly is control water content and two technical indicators of mixture homogeneity.Other no specific (special) requirements.
The said batching of the present invention is corn flour, potato dry powder, wheat bran skin, soya-bean cake, fish meal oyster spiro powder, trace element, salt etc.
Of the present invention that fresh grain stillage is admixed the technical process that the fodder yeast bacterium ferments is simple, can improve protein content 5%~7%.Be that a kind of time is short, the technique processing method that technological requirement is low does not need to increase new process equipment, and to improving quality of the fodder, significant effect has reduced production costs.
Big at potato distiller's dried grain water content, the viscosity height, the characteristics that granularity is little, the present invention has adopted and has sneaked into rice husk or distills ' grains is the combination drying method of carrier, can adapt to vibrated fluidized bed formula drying machine and directly the fresh grain stillage after the fermentation be carried out drying, it is suitable process that the original stoving process that can't implement with this process equipment becomes, thereby whole technical process is had breakthrough.Solved the difficult problem that traditional potato distiller's dried grain difficulty is processed as dry feed.
Below the prescription of the vinasse mixed feed described in the present invention is done introduction:
Prescription 1: be fit to 20Kg~60Kg growth section fattening pig
Distiller's dried grain (water content 10~14%) 500 weight portions
Corn flour 290 weight portions
Potato dry powder 100 weight portions
Soya-bean cake powder 70 weight portions
Oyster spiro powder, trace element and salt are an amount of
Prescription 2: be fit to 60kg~90kg growth section fattening pig
Distiller's dried grain (water content 10~14%) 500 weight portions
Corn flour 270 weight portions
Potato dry powder 120 weight portions
Soya-bean cake powder 60 weight portions
Oyster spiro powder, trace element and salt 5 weight portions
The formula rate of above-mentioned mixed feed generally can be controlled in the following scope:
Distiller's dried grain (water content 10~14%) 450~550 weight portions
Corn flour 250~280 weight portions
Potato dry powder 100~140 weight portions
Soya-bean cake powder 50~80 weight portions
Oyster spiro powder, trace element and salt 3~8 weight portions
This vinasse mixed feed as long as add an amount of water, is in harmonious proportion and evenly can feeds in use.
The vinasse mixed feed that makes according to process of the present invention has following advantage:
1, nutritious palatability is strong.After adopting the fermentation of fodder yeast bacterium, improved Protein content in the vinasse,, reduced higher alcohol, acidic materials and volatilization fat in the poor liquid of vinasse through Separation of Solid and Liquid, eliminate the factor that is unfavorable for livestock and poultry feed and digestion, thereby strengthened the palatability of feed greatly.
2, can increase the appetite of livestock and poultry, be easy to control the moisture content of feed.In drying course, a part of starch is formed dextrin by gelatinization, and generation can improve the fragrance of appetite of livestock and poultry, and livestock and poultry are liked edible.In addition,, be easy to control the water consumption of raising, help scientific feeding because the Shi Jiashui that feeds mixes and stirs.

As can be seen from the test results:
1, the vinasse that add some (35%-70%) are made different vinasse mixed feeds, can reach the trophic level of feeding fattening pig fully.
2, vinasse nutrition is abundanter, and the source is wider, can substitute grain in the mixed feed (as wheat bran, corn, melon dried etc.) effectively, and its feeding effect is good, and cost is low:
(1) the A test group is compared with contrast groups, and one kilogram of pig of every weightening finish can be saved feed 840 grams.And the A test group is compared with control group, many weightening finish 100 grams of average pig every day.
(2) each test group one kilogram of pig that all increases weight, feed cost has reduced 1.290-1.866 unit than control group.
3, the ethanol that contains trace in the vinasse mixed feed, can improve the feed taste, prevent feed mold, extend shelf life, simultaneously, after pig ingested, adequate amount of ethanol had both helped the metabolic activity from body, limited the in vitro activity (easily sleeping) of pig again thus promoting its nutrition with picked-up to be converted into self stores.

Utilize process provided by the present invention to produce the industrial enterprise of vinasse mixed feed, its economic benefit and social benefit also are very considerable, calculate by the production scale of producing 5000 tons of vinasse per year, need 400,000 yuan of investments, can form the suitability for industrialized production ability, annual recyclable distiller's dried grain (moisture 14%) 2000 tons can produce 5000 tons of mixed feeds.If by 440 yuan/ton of mixing average unit costs, 560 yuan of/ton calculating of price, about 600,000 yuan of year contribution taxes, 1 year is recoverable fully invested.
Prove that through the fattening pig feeding trial this mixed feed feeding effect is better, average meat feed ratio is 1: 4, can produce about 1250 tons of live pigs the whole year, and 3,500,000 yuan of wound social output can be saved 2000 tons of feed-use grains simultaneously, and social benefit is considerable.
Because poor reuse of water and separating of solid content, the gross contamination load can descend about 80%, has alleviated environmental pollution greatly, if can implement to handle to the poor water of intermittent discharge, and can thorough pollution abatement.
Below introduce a specific embodiment of the present invention in detail.So as to further disclosure whole technology contents of the present invention.Specific embodiment is: some wine lees liquor input horizontal spiral discharge sedimentation centrifuges are carried out Separation of Solid and Liquid, obtain the fresh grain stillage of water content about 75%.Get the fodder yeast bacterium liquid that the 100kg fresh grain stillage adds the 5kg maturation, the nature that stirs was placed on the normal temperature laboratory bottom fermentation 24 hours.The rice husk that the adds vinasse volume 30 percent volume then uniform mixing in the mixer of packing into, again the vinasse that mix are sent in the vibrated fluidized bed formula drying machine and dried, obtain the distiller's dried grain granule of about 39kg water content about 14%, it is sent into carry out carrier in the carrier seperator and separate, obtain the distiller's dried grain thing of 30kg.With pulverizer 30kg distiller's dried grain thing is pulverized the back and amount to 0.3kg together with components such as corn flour 16kg, potato dry powder 7.2kg, wheat bran skin 2.4kg, soya-bean cake 3.6kg, Fish powder 0.6kg and oyster spiro powder, trace element, salt and put into mixer and mix, make the vinasse mixed feed of about 60kg.
